Short description
The coloration is variable, ranging from pale greenish-gray to pale reddish-yellow and scarlet. They often have five or six faint dark stripes, the last of which is on the caudal peduncle. The scales on the upper body have a light center and a dark posterior edge, creating a vague checkered pattern. A distinctive feature is the black or dark brown triangular spots at the apex of each hard ray of the dorsal fin. The eyes often have a narrow black rim.
